The EC210 Volvo Excavator: Thorough Dive into Vecu Systems

The EC210 Volvo Excavator is a robust machine known for its performance. One of the key components that sets it apart is the integrated Vecu system. This sophisticated technology plays a crucial role in enhancing the excavator's overall functionality. Vecu systems use electronic devices to collect data on various aspects of the machine, such as engine parameters, hydraulic flow, and working environment. This information is then analyzed by a central control unit to adjust the excavator's systems in real time.

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their reliability and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ate volvo ec210 vecu syst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By manipulating vir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to experiment various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

ECU Simulation Software for Volvo Trucks: Realistic Testing Environments

Developing and refining the Electronic Control Units (ECUs) which Volvo trucks necessitates meticulous testing in various range of simulated environments. ECU simulation software facilitates engineers to construct highly realistic virtual testbeds that replicate the complexities of real-world driving scenarios. These simulations provide a safe and controlled setting for testing ECU performance under diverse conditions, such as fluctuating temperatures, terrain, and loads.

  • Advantages of using ECU simulation software include reduced development time, cost savings through elimination of physical prototypes, and the ability to pinpoint potential issues early in the design process.
